How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 12183?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
12183 Studio Apartments | $1,575 | $1,150 | $1,800 |
12183 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,754 | $1,050 | $2,225 |
12183 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,088 | $1,119 | $3,880 |
12183 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,798 | $999 | $3,207 |
12183 4 Bedroom Apartments | $965 | $965 | $965 |
